def make_triton_contiguous(t): |
|
"""Return input as a triton-contiguous tensor. |
|
|
|
A triton-contiguous tensor is defined as a tensor that has strides |
|
with minimal value equal to 1. |
|
|
|
While triton kernels support triton-non-contiguous tensors (all |
|
strides being greater than 1 or having 0 strides) arguments, a |
|
considerable slow-down occurs because tensor data is copied |
|
element-wise rather than chunk-wise. |
|
""" |
|
if min(t.stride()) != 1: |
|
|
|
|
|
return t.contiguous() |
|
else: |
|
return t |

def scatter_mm(blocks, others, indices_data, *, accumulators=None): |
|
"""Scattered matrix multiplication of tensors. |
|
|
|
A scattered matrix multiplication is defined as a series of matrix |
|
multiplications applied to input tensors according to the input |
|
and output mappings specified by indices data. |
|
|
|
The following indices data formats are supported for defining a |
|
scattered matrix multiplication operation (:attr:`indices_data[0]` |
|
holds the name of the indices data format as specified below): |
|
|
|
- ``"scatter_mm"`` - matrix multiplications scattered in batches |
|
of tensors. |
|
|
|
If :attr:`blocks` is a :math:`(* \times M \times K) tensor, |
|
:attr:`others` is a :math:`(* \times K \times N)` tensor, |
|
:attr:`accumulators` is a :math:`(* \times M \times N)` tensor, |
|
and :attr:`indices = indices_data['indices']` is a :math:`(* |
|
\times 3)` tensor, then the operation is equivalent to the |
|
following code:: |
|
|
|
c_offsets, pq = indices_data[1:] |
|
for r in range(len(c_offsets) - 1): |
|
for g in range(c_offsets[r], c_offsets[r + 1]): |
|
p, q = pq[g] |
|
accumulators[r] += blocks[p] @ others[q] |
|
|
|
- ``"bsr_strided_mm"`` - matrix multiplications scattered in |
|
batches of tensors and a tensor. |
|
|
|
If :attr:`blocks` is a :math:`(Ms \times Ks) tensor, |
|
:attr:`others` is a :math:`(* \times K \times N)` tensor, |
|
:attr:`accumulators` is a :math:`(* \times M \times N)` tensor, then |
|
the operation is equivalent to the following code:: |
|
|
|
c_indices, r_offsets, p_offsets, q_offsets, meta = indices_data[1:] |
|
for b in range(nbatches): |
|
for i, r in enumerate(r_offsets): |
|
r0, r1 = divmod(r, N) |
|
acc = accumulators[b, r0:r0 + Ms, r1:r1 + Ns] |
|
for g in range(c_indices[i], c_indices[i+1]): |
|
p = p_offsets[g] |
|
q0, q1 = divmod(q_offsets[g], N) |
|
acc += blocks[p] @ others[b, q0:q0 + Ks, q1:q1 + Ns] |
|
|
|
where ``Ns = N // meta['SPLIT_N']``, and ``M`` and ``K`` are |
|
integer multiples of ``Ms`` and ``Ks``, respectively. |
|
|
|
- ``"bsr_strided_mm_compressed"`` - matrix multiplications |
|
scattered in batches of tensors and a tensor. A memory and |
|
processor efficient version of ``"bsr_strided_mm"`` format. If |
|
:attr:`blocks` is a :math:`(Ms \times Ks) tensor, :attr:`others` |
|
is a :math:`(* \times K \times N)` tensor, :attr:`accumulators` |
|
is a :math:`(* \times M \times N)` tensor, then the operation is |
|
equivalent to the following code:: |
|
|
|
c_indices, r_offsets, q_offsets, meta = indices_data[1:] |
|
for b in range(nbatches): |
|
for r in r_offsets: |
|
m = (r // N) // Ms |
|
n = (r % N) // Ns |
|
r0, r1 = divmod(r, N) |
|
c0, c1 = c_indices[m], c_indices[m + 1] |
|
acc = accumulators[b, r0:r0 + Ms, r1:r1 + Ns] |
|
for i, p in enumerate(range(c0, c1)): |
|
q = q_offsets[n * c1 + (SPLIT_N - n) * c0 + i] |
|
q0, q1 = divmod(q, N) |
|
acc += blocks[p] @ others[b, q0:q0 + Ks, q1:q1 + Ns] |
|
|
|
where ``Ns = N // meta['SPLIT_N']``, and ``M`` and ``K`` are |
|
integer multiples of ``Ms`` and ``Ks``, respectively. |
|
|
|
Notice that the order of ``r_offsets`` items can be arbitrary; |
|
this property enables defining swizzle operators via |
|
rearrangements of ``r_offsets`` items.. |
|
|
|
Auxilary functions are provided for pre-computing |
|
:attr:`indices_data`. For example, |
|
:func:`bsr_scatter_mm_indices_data` is used to define indices data |
|
for matrix multiplication of BSR and strided tensors. |
|
|
|
Parameters |
|
---------- |
|
blocks (Tensor): a 3-D tensor of first matrices to be multiplied |
|
|
|
others (Tensor): a tensor of second matrices to be multiplied. If |
|
``indices_data[0]=="scatter_mm"``, the tensor is a 1-D batch |
|
tensor of second input matrices to be multiplied. Otherwise, the |
|
second input matrices are slices of the :attr:`others` tensor. |
|
indices_data (tuple): a format data that defines the inputs and |
|
outputs of scattered matrix multiplications. |
|
|
|
Keyword arguments |
|
----------------- |
|
|
|
accumulators (Tensor, optional): a tensor of matrix product |
|
accumulators. If ``indices_data[0]=="scatter_mm"``, the tensor |
|
is a 1-D batch tensor of output matrices. Otherwise, output |
|
matrices are slices of the :attr:`accumulators` tensor. |
|
""" |

class TensorAsKey: |
|
"""A light-weight wrapper of a tensor that enables storing tensors as |
|
keys with efficient memory reference based comparision as an |
|
approximation to data equality based keys. |
|
|
|
Motivation: the hash value of a torch tensor is tensor instance |
|
based that does not use data equality and makes the usage of |
|
tensors as keys less useful. For instance, the result of |
|
``len({a.crow_indices(), a.crow_indices()})`` is `2`, although, |
|
the tensor results from `crow_indices` method call are equal, in |
|
fact, these share the same data storage. |
|
On the other hand, for efficient caching of tensors we want to |
|
avoid calling torch.equal that compares tensors item-wise. |
|
|
|
TensorAsKey offers a compromise in that it guarantees key equality |
|
of tensors that references data in the same storage in the same |
|
manner and without accessing underlying data. However, this |
|
approach does not always guarantee correctness. For instance, for |
|
a complex tensor ``x``, we have ``TensorAsKey(x) == |
|
TensorAsKey(x.conj())`` while ``torch.equal(x, x.conj())`` would |
|
return False. |
|
""" |
